Travis Kelce Fans Declare He Is ‘Killing It’ in ‘Are You Smarter Than a Celebrity?’ Hosting Debut

Travis Kelce might be a pro on the football field, but it seems he also has a natural talent for hosting a television show. Fans of the Kansas City Chiefs tight end are raving about his performance on Amazon Prime Video’s Are You Smarter Than a Celebrity?.

The NFL star, 35, made his debut as a game show host when the first three episodes of Prime Video’s Are You Smarter Than a 5th Grader? spinoff premiered on Wednesday, October 16. Similar to the original show, Are You Smarter Than a Celebrity? sees contestants enlist help from celebs to answer 11 questions on a range of subjects from elementary-level curriculum. Travis’ job is to explain the rules, read the questions and provide the typical TV host’s level of entertainment.

After the first three episodes dropped on Prime Video, fans started sharing their initial reactions online. The general consensus seems to be that Travis is doing a great job as host, despite it being his first time in such a role.

“I keep yelling the answers like it’s my $100,000 on the line haha. Travis Kelce is pretty entertaining as the host and [Chad ‘Ochocinco’ Johnson], Nikki Glaser, Natasha [Leggero], [Lilly] Singh and [Ron] Funches are fun!” one fan wrote on X, calling out the celebrity guests in the first three episodes.

“Travis Kelce [a.k.a.] Killa Trav absolutely KILLED it on Are You Smarter Than A Celebrity!!” another user shared.

“I finished the first three episodes of Are You Smarter Than a Celebrity… and all I have to say is TRAV IS ABSOLUTELY KILLING IT,” a third person wrote on the social media platform.

“Travis is sooo good in Are You Smarter Than A Celebrity like he’s a pro. Wow,” a fourth fan commented.

While the reviews of his hosting gig have so far been positive, the footballer admitted on his “New Heights” podcast with brother Jason Kelce on Wednesday that he was “terrified” of what people would say.

“There are a few twists to this game, and, I do a great job of describing it in the episodes. So you’ll get caught up to all the rules and regulations that we got going on with the celebrities and how the celebrities can help you out,” Travis said, although he added that he is a “terrible reader.” He said he prepared for this by practicing as much as possible.

“I was kinda like quizzing myself going through the questions in the back, just making sure,” he continued. “I would read them once just so, because I’m a terrible reader, so I would make sure I would get all the pronunciations done and corrected in the background.”

Though he was nervous, Travis said he had “so much fun” filming the first season of Are You Smarter Than a Celebrity?.

“I never in a million years thought I was ever going to be an actual host of a game show,” he said. “I always thought it was gonna be fun to, like, maybe go on one of the game shows. And then somebody asked me, ‘Do you wanna host it?’ I used to mimic all the game show hosts as a kid.”

Travis was announced as the host of Are You Smarter Than a Celebrity? in April. His game show debut comes just weeks after he made his acting debut in Ryan Murphy’s horror series Grotesquerie on FX.

New episodes of Are You Smarter Than a Celebrity? drop on Amazon Prime Video on Wednesdays.
